Black Friday is a chance to get a good deal on Christmas gifts, and to spoil yourself of course, and it has taken Canada by storm.

CF Lime Ridge was very busy today. It opened early, at 7 am, for people who wanted to get those deals first thing this morning.

“This is the best time to do it, Black Friday. There are so many sales, so many good deals, so this is perfect time to shop”

Among the most popular items were fuzzy socks from Old Navy for $1.

“They are really soft and they are fuzzy, and the toes and tops of the socks have different designs”

“We’ve got reindeer, we got cheetah print”

And while CF Lime Ridge and other big box stores around town were flooded with deals, many local shops have a different opinion about the mad dash to save some money.

“Well I think they are doing a disservice to their business. They are training their customer base to buy on sale”

Angela Demontigny is the owner of Demontigny Boutique on James Street North. She says customers who shop along the strip are looking for unique pieces as opposed to deals.

“People are making things that are very unique and are not carrying a huge amount of inventory like big box stores”

On Ottawa Street there were a few shops participating in Black Friday and the best deal at Orange Tree Boutique is their winter coats.

“We have one regular price of $225, it is at $169 with no tax today”

One customer came in to treat herself to a bracelet to wear for her Christmas parties, and that also was exempt from tax.

The majority of the customers on James Street North and Ottawa Street didn’t go looking for deals. And many local shop owners said their customers don’t expect to save big bucks, but that was certainly not the case at CF Lime Ridge where everyone was running around looking for deals.
